Gazpacho Recipe

This is Darren Marshall (Head Chef at Island Grill, overlooking Hyde Park)’s recipe for gazpacho. It is the one his wife’s family makes at home in Galicia (North of Spain). Serves 4 ½ onion 2 cloves of garlic ½ cucumber 6 ripe plum tomatoes 75ml olive oil 75ml water 2tblsp sherry vinegar small handful of basil Lightly cook the onions and garlic in a pan, then mix all of the ingredients…

SUMMER SOFA SYNDROME: Summer holidays pose a serious health risk to 4.3 million UK children

Six glorious weeks of freedom might sound like a dream come true, but research from weight management company, MoreLife, reveals that the school holidays are turning into a very real nightmare, posing a serious health risk to 4.3 million children across the UK. A third of British children (33%) will fall victim to ‘Summer Sofa Syndrome’ this year, with some putting on up to half a stone…
